Book launch Rem before Koolhaas: Journalism by an Architect
Rem before Koolhaas: Journalism by an Architect is a book by Antonio Cantero about Rem Koolhaas’s early work as a journalist in the sixties. Offering a fresh look at this period and including a new interview with Koolhaas, Cantero explores how Koolhaas’s interviews often became essayistic pieces that register power dynamics, social realities and cultural shifts within a specific media ecology.

Haagse Post 1963-1967
Rem before Koolhaas is the first book to uncover Rem Koolhaas’s early work as a journalist for Haagse Post between 1963 and 1967. Featuring original Haagse Post layouts and first-time English translations, Cantero’s book reveals Koolhaas as both an observer of his time and an interviewer for whom writing became a space for learning.
Rather than treating journalism as a biographical precursor to his architectural career, Rem before Koolhaas presents it not as a professional identity but as a retrospective position from which this body of work can be read on its own terms.
